The Air Force plans to mature extended-range technology for its Block 5 MQ-9 Reapers under an undefinitized contract action issued March 30, a service spokesman said this week. New capabilities also will be added to the Block 5 fleet every nine to 18 months based on Air Combat Command's priorities to fix 19 Category I deficiencies found during follow-on test and evaluation, the MQ-9 program office said through an Aug. 7 email from spokesman Brian Brackens.
